Output 66c2d95c4d09401fe61f10e062c6ef3642f0619b86346fae4a76fc1131482f05:1

value
4297308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289aa242546908837d53942368da56c386c7b02f OP_EQUALVERIFY OP_CHECKSIG
address
14hhGpYVvwBmVjmqBfN2dcY6qG17PxRABs
transaction
66c2d95c4d09401fe61f10e062c6ef3642f0619b86346fae4a76fc1131482f05
spent
true